16 That are black because of ice, By them doth snow hide  itself.
         
                                
                        17 By the time they are warm they have been cut off, By its  being hot they have been Extinguished from their place.
         
                                
                        18 Turn aside do the paths of their way, They ascend into  emptiness, and are lost.
         
                                
                        19 Passengers of Tema looked expectingly, Travellers of Sheba  hoped for them.
         
                                
                        20 They were ashamed that one hath trusted, They have come  unto it and are confounded.
         
                                
                        21 Surely now ye have become the same! Ye see a downfall, and  are afraid.
         
                                
                        22 Is it because I said, Give to me? And, By your power bribe  for me?
